Biographical Note
Edwin T. Martin, author and educator, was born June 2, 1905 in Marshallville, Georgia, and died January 22, 1968 in Atlanta, Georgia. He was educated at Emory University (B.A., 1928; M.A., 1929) and at the University of Wisconsin (Ph.D., 1942); taught American literature and other English courses at Emory University (1929-1968); and served in the Army Air Corps in the African-Sicily-Italy theater (1942-1945). He was the author of a book on the scientific work of Thomas Jefferson.
Scope and Content Note
The collection consists of the papers of Edwin T. Martin from 1940-1987. The papers include manuscripts, correspondence, clippings, and personal military records. Manuscripts are of Martin's unpublished writings and contain information about his military service; correspondence is primarily with colleagues and concern his publications and professional activities; clippings include reviews of his book on Thomas Jefferson and biographical information about Martin; military records relate to his service in World War II and in the reserves.
